Output d85fb569519fc14ca46dd94a32ee23ced4f620040d56fcfca9f0cee64d25cf42:9

value
622616
script pubkey
OP_0 OP_PUSHBYTES_20 44655cb260d86bce838319bcb61e8793a8890b29
address
bc1qg3j4evnqmp4uaqurrx7tv858jw5gjzefwrmvr0
transaction
d85fb569519fc14ca46dd94a32ee23ced4f620040d56fcfca9f0cee64d25cf42
confirmations
192273
spent
true